I want to create a new group, I create one, and it appears on the legend, is there any way to remove it from the legend? I tried using a "Hidden group" but if I add someone to the group, it doesn't colour their name, and I did tick colour group members.
Are there any Codes, or Editing I need to do? Or is this not possible.

You could remmove them with this
Though you could make it a hidden grup and color grup names based on their href value. Would that be OK?
Hope I'm not missing something simplier
You can add it to CSS, change the ID to that users ID and add the color code you want. He'd be in a hidden grup but he'd have the color from CSS.
- Code:
a[href="/g13-head-admin"] {
display: none;
}
a[href="/g15-king-coder"] {
display: none;
}
Though you could make it a hidden grup and color grup names based on their href value. Would that be OK?
Hope I'm not missing something simplier
You can add it to CSS, change the ID to that users ID and add the color code you want. He'd be in a hidden grup but he'd have the color from CSS.
- Code:
a[href="/uUSER ID"]{
text-decoration: none !important;
color: #COLOR CODE HERE !important;
font-weight: bold;
}
